Compare all timetables for the bus from Pietermaritzburg to Midrand
Cheapest bus trips tomorrow
-
Intercape7h 25m009:50PietermaritzburgBurger St. Coach Station17:15MidrandEngen Big Bird0EconomyA Bus from Intercape go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 20/05/2025 09:50:00 to Engen Big Bird, Midrand (South Africa) arriving at 20/05/2025 17:15:00. 50 Economy ticket for £12 per person are available. Travel duration is 7h 25m
-
Big Sky Intercity7h 25m009:50PietermaritzburgBurger St. Coach Station17:15MidrandEngen Big Bird0EconomyA Bus from Big Sky Intercity go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 20/05/2025 09:50:00 to Engen Big Bird, Midrand (South Africa) arriving at 20/05/2025 17:15:00. 50 Economy ticket for £12 per person are available. Travel duration is 7h 25m
-
Eagle Liner7h 35m010:05PietermaritzburgBurger St. Coach Station17:40MidrandEngen Big Bird0EconomyA Bus from Eagle Liner go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 20/05/2025 10:05:00 to Engen Big Bird, Midrand (South Africa) arriving at 20/05/2025 17:40:00. 50 Economy ticket for £12 per person are available. Travel duration is 7h 35m
-
Citiliner7h 40m010:05PietermaritzburgBurger St. Coach Station17:45MidrandEngen Big Bird0EconomyA Bus from Citiliner go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 20/05/2025 10:05:00 to Engen Big Bird, Midrand (South Africa) arriving at 20/05/2025 17:45:00. 50 Economy ticket for £15 per person are available. Travel duration is 7h 40m
-
Greyhound Australia8h 5m020:45PietermaritzburgBurger St. Coach Station04:50MidrandEngen Big Bird0EconomyA Bus from Greyhound Australia go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 20/05/2025 20:45:00 to Engen Big Bird, Midrand (South Africa) arriving at 21/05/2025 04:50:00. 50 Economy ticket for £16 per person are available. Travel duration is 8h 5m
Cheapest bus trips Wednesday
-
Intercape7h 40m023:20PietermaritzburgBurger St. Coach Station07:00MidrandEngen Big Bird0EconomyA Bus from Intercape go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 21/05/2025 23:20:00 to Engen Big Bird, Midrand (South Africa) arriving at 22/05/2025 07:00:00. 50 Economy ticket for £12 per person are available. Travel duration is 7h 40m
-
Eagle Liner7h 35m010:05PietermaritzburgBurger St. Coach Station17:40MidrandEngen Big Bird0EconomyA Bus from Eagle Liner go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 21/05/2025 10:05:00 to Engen Big Bird, Midrand (South Africa) arriving at 21/05/2025 17:40:00. 50 Economy ticket for £13 per person are available. Travel duration is 7h 35m
-
Big Sky Intercity7h 40m023:20PietermaritzburgBurger St. Coach Station07:00MidrandEngen Big Bird0EconomyA Bus from Big Sky Intercity go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 21/05/2025 23:20:00 to Engen Big Bird, Midrand (South Africa) arriving at 22/05/2025 07:00:00. 50 Economy ticket for £13 per person are available. Travel duration is 7h 40m
-
Citiliner7h 40m010:05PietermaritzburgBurger St. Coach Station17:45MidrandEngen Big Bird0EconomyA Bus from Citiliner go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 21/05/2025 10:05:00 to Engen Big Bird, Midrand (South Africa) arriving at 21/05/2025 17:45:00. 50 Economy ticket for £15 per person are available. Travel duration is 7h 40m
-
Delta Coaches6h 55m022:55PietermaritzburgBurger St. Coach Station05:50MidrandEngen Big Bird0First ClassA Bus from Delta Coaches go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 21/05/2025 22:55:00 to Engen Big Bird, Midrand (South Africa) arriving at 22/05/2025 05:50:00. 50 First Class ticket for £15 per person are available. Travel duration is 6h 55m
Cheapest bus trips Thursday
-
Eagle Liner7h 35m010:05PietermaritzburgBurger St. Coach Station17:40MidrandEngen Big Bird0EconomyA Bus from Eagle Liner go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 22/05/2025 10:05:00 to Engen Big Bird, Midrand (South Africa) arriving at 22/05/2025 17:40:00. 50 Economy ticket for £13 per person are available. Travel duration is 7h 35m
-
Intercape7h 25m008:50PietermaritzburgBurger St. Coach Station16:15MidrandEngen Big Bird0EconomyA Bus from Intercape go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 22/05/2025 08:50:00 to Engen Big Bird, Midrand (South Africa) arriving at 22/05/2025 16:15:00. 50 Economy ticket for £13 per person are available. Travel duration is 7h 25m
-
Big Sky Intercity7h 25m009:50PietermaritzburgBurger St. Coach Station17:15MidrandEngen Big Bird0EconomyA Bus from Big Sky Intercity go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 22/05/2025 09:50:00 to Engen Big Bird, Midrand (South Africa) arriving at 22/05/2025 17:15:00. 50 Economy ticket for £13 per person are available. Travel duration is 7h 25m
-
Citiliner7h 40m010:05PietermaritzburgBurger St. Coach Station17:45MidrandEngen Big Bird0EconomyA Bus from Citiliner go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 22/05/2025 10:05:00 to Engen Big Bird, Midrand (South Africa) arriving at 22/05/2025 17:45:00. 50 Economy ticket for £15 per person are available. Travel duration is 7h 40m
-
Delta Coaches6h 55m022:55PietermaritzburgBurger St. Coach Station05:50MidrandEngen Big Bird0First ClassA Bus from Delta Coaches go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 22/05/2025 22:55:00 to Engen Big Bird, Midrand (South Africa) arriving at 23/05/2025 05:50:00. 50 First Class ticket for £15 per person are available. Travel duration is 6h 55m
Cheapest bus trips Friday
-
Intercape7h 25m009:50PietermaritzburgBurger St. Coach Station17:15MidrandEngen Big Bird0EconomyA Bus from Intercape go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 23/05/2025 09:50:00 to Engen Big Bird, Midrand (South Africa) arriving at 23/05/2025 17:15:00. 50 Economy ticket for £12 per person are available. Travel duration is 7h 25m
-
Intercape7h 40m023:20PietermaritzburgBurger St. Coach Station07:00MidrandEngen Big Bird0EconomyA Bus from Intercape go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 23/05/2025 23:20:00 to Engen Big Bird, Midrand (South Africa) arriving at 24/05/2025 07:00:00. 50 Economy ticket for £12 per person are available. Travel duration is 7h 40m
-
Intercape7h 25m008:50PietermaritzburgBurger St. Coach Station16:15MidrandEngen Big Bird0EconomyA Bus from Intercape go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 23/05/2025 08:50:00 to Engen Big Bird, Midrand (South Africa) arriving at 23/05/2025 16:15:00. 50 Economy ticket for £13 per person are available. Travel duration is 7h 25m
-
Intercape9h 10m009:20PietermaritzburgBurger St. Coach Station18:30MidrandEngen Big Bird0EconomyA Bus from Intercape go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 23/05/2025 09:20:00 to Engen Big Bird, Midrand (South Africa) arriving at 23/05/2025 18:30:00. 50 Economy ticket for £13 per person are available. Travel duration is 9h 10m
-
Intercape8h 40m011:50PietermaritzburgBurger St. Coach Station20:30MidrandEngen Big Bird0EconomyA Bus from Intercape go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 23/05/2025 11:50:00 to Engen Big Bird, Midrand (South Africa) arriving at 23/05/2025 20:30:00. 50 Economy ticket for £13 per person are available. Travel duration is 8h 40m
Cheapest bus trips Saturday
-
Intercape7h 25m009:50PietermaritzburgBurger St. Coach Station17:15MidrandEngen Big Bird0EconomyA Bus from Intercape go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 24/05/2025 09:50:00 to Engen Big Bird, Midrand (South Africa) arriving at 24/05/2025 17:15:00. 50 Economy ticket for £13 per person are available. Travel duration is 7h 25m
-
Eagle Liner7h 35m010:05PietermaritzburgBurger St. Coach Station17:40MidrandEngen Big Bird0EconomyA Bus from Eagle Liner go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 24/05/2025 10:05:00 to Engen Big Bird, Midrand (South Africa) arriving at 24/05/2025 17:40:00. 50 Economy ticket for £13 per person are available. Travel duration is 7h 35m
-
Big Sky Intercity7h 25m009:50PietermaritzburgBurger St. Coach Station17:15MidrandEngen Big Bird0EconomyA Bus from Big Sky Intercity go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 24/05/2025 09:50:00 to Engen Big Bird, Midrand (South Africa) arriving at 24/05/2025 17:15:00. 50 Economy ticket for £14 per person are available. Travel duration is 7h 25m
-
Citiliner7h 40m010:00PietermaritzburgBurger St. Coach Station17:40MidrandEngen Big Bird0EconomyA Bus from Citiliner go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 24/05/2025 10:00:00 to Engen Big Bird, Midrand (South Africa) arriving at 24/05/2025 17:40:00. 50 Economy ticket for £16 per person are available. Travel duration is 7h 40m
-
Greyhound Australia8h 5m020:45PietermaritzburgBurger St. Coach Station04:50MidrandEngen Big Bird0EconomyA Bus from Greyhound Australia goes from Burger St. Coach Station, Pietermaritzburg (South Africa) at 24/05/2025 20:45:00 to Engen Big Bird, Midrand (South Africa) arriving at 25/05/2025 04:50:00. 50 Economy ticket for £16 per person are available. Travel duration is 8h 5m
Frequency of bus connections between Pietermaritzburg and Midrand
Facts about coaches from Pietermaritzburg to Midrand
Compare all providers like Intercape, Eagle Liner and Intercity Xpress that travel 38 times every day by bus from Pietermaritzburg to Midrand in one click! Book your bus ticket from Pietermaritzburg to Midrand starting from £12!
Cheapest Bus | £12 |
Fastest Bus | 5h 45m |
Earliest Coach | 00:10 |
Latest Coach | 23:55 |
Daily Bus Connections | 38 Ø |
Distance | 460.7 km |
Coach Companies | Intercape, Eagle Liner, Intercity Xpress, Citiliner, Big Sky Intercity, Greyhound Australia and Delta Coaches |
Cheapest coach connections from Pietermaritzburg to Midrand
Every day, 38 buses from 7 coach companies leave Pietermaritzburg for Midrand: in the table below, you will find the cheapest prices for a bus ticket for this route, starting from 19/05/2025 and for the following days.
The cheapest time to travel from Pietermaritzburg to Midrand
How to save money travelling from Pietermaritzburg to Midrand
Book the ticket from Pietermaritzburg to Midrand in advance! The earlier you book, the cheaper usually the price is. Also, you will be sure to have a place on the bus from Pietermaritzburg to Midrand, compared instead if you buy it at the last moment, or directly at the station.
If you can, avoid travelling at peak times. Instead of weekend, try travelling during the week. Travelling in the evening or at night it’s also cheaper, and later coaches from Pietermaritzburg to Midrand are also emptier.All bus stations and stops in Pietermaritzburg and Midrand
The map below shows you where to find all the bus stations in Pietermaritzburg and Midrand.
Service and Comfort on the bus from Pietermaritzburg to Midrand
FAQs about the Pietermaritzburg to Midrand bus
How much does a Pietermaritzburg - Midrand coach trip cost?
How much could I save by comparing buses from Pietermaritzburg to Midrand?
How many connections are available for the Pietermaritzburg - Midrand route on average every day?
How long does a bus to Midrand from Pietermaritzburg take?
What time is the first bus from Pietermaritzburg to Midrand?
What time is the last coach from Pietermaritzburg to Midrand?
Which bus companies serve the Pietermaritzburg - Midrand route?
Is there a direct bus between Pietermaritzburg and Midrand?
What can I take with me on the bus to Midrand from Pietermaritzburg?
What equipment is available for the Pietermaritzburg Midrand bus route?
Available seat classes which are offered on the bus route Pietermaritzburg to Midrand
The cheapest option available for your ticket, it usually comes with reclinable seats and AC.
Best of the best: you will find the most comfortable accommodation to work or relax during your travel.
More bus routes to Pietermaritzburg and to Midrand
- Bus Routes to Pietermaritzburg
- Bus to Pietermaritzburg from Bellville
- Coach Bloemfontein to Pietermaritzburg
- Bus from Cape Town to Pietermaritzburg
- Coaches East London to Pietermaritzburg
- Buses George to Pietermaritzburg
- Coach Germiston to Pietermaritzburg
- Bus from Harrismith to Pietermaritzburg
- Coach to Pietermaritzburg from Johannesburg
- King William's Town to Pietermaritzburg coach
- Buses Klerksdorp to Pietermaritzburg
- Coach from Lusikisiki to Pietermaritzburg
- Mount Frere to Pietermaritzburg coach
- Coach to Pietermaritzburg from Mthatha
- Port Elizabeth to Pietermaritzburg coach
- Pretoria to Pietermaritzburg coach
- Coaches Welkom to Pietermaritzburg
- Bus Routes to Midrand
- Bus to Midrand from Bulawayo
- Buses East London to Midrand
- Bus to Midrand from Harare
- Kimberley to Midrand bus
- Coach Kuruman to Midrand
- Buses Ladysmith to Midrand
- Coach from Margate (ZA) to Midrand
- Buses Matatiele to Midrand
- Mokopane to Midrand coach
- Bus from Mount Frere to Midrand
- Coaches Phalaborwa to Midrand
- Coach from Polokwane to Midrand
- Coach from Port Elizabeth to Midrand
- Bus Port Shepstone to Midrand
- Coach Queenstown (ZA) to Midrand
- Bus Richards Bay to Midrand
- Coach from Tzaneen to Midrand